Lifting rubber strip for shower room
Technical Field
The invention relates to the manufacturing industry of a shower room, in particular to a lifting rubber strip for the shower room.
Background
At present, the existing shower room structure mostly adopts two structures of a traditional ground sliding type or a hanging sliding type, and the two structures both need to be provided with a waterproof barrier strip higher than the ground, so that the phenomenon that water flows overflow outwards in the bathing process and the effect of dry-wet separation cannot be achieved is avoided;
although the two installation modes solve the problem of water retaining, the existing installation modes have higher waterproof barrier strips and pulley baffles, so that the waterproof barrier strips or the baffles need to be crossed when the shower room is entered, and the shower room is inconvenient for some disabled persons or old people and children; therefore, research and development personnel set a low-barrier or barrier-free shower room, and realize the lifting of the shower glass by utilizing a lifting structure, namely the shower glass is lifted and displaced in the process of pushing the door to open and is descended when the door is closed for shower use, the whole shower glass descends, and the shower glass is prevented from water after integrally descending; this mode satisfies low obstacle promptly, can solve waterproof, seal water scheduling problem again, but its in the use, has following defect: (1) The overall lifting structure of the shower glass is too complex, and the installation and assembly are difficult, so that the cost is too high, and the market competitiveness is weak; (2) The house is not suitable for various house types, and except for a straight house type, other house types are difficult to realize; (3) The shower glass is heavy, particularly a hanging-sliding structure, the lifting design is difficult to realize, the whole shower room door opening and closing structure is seriously influenced due to the whole weight of the shower glass, the problems of unsmooth sliding, serious abrasion of sliding parts and the like occur after the shower glass is used for a period of time, the shower glass cannot lift in place due to the unsmooth integral structure, and finally water retaining and sealing cannot be realized; in conclusion, the existing shower room lifting structure still needs to be further improved.
Disclosure of Invention
The invention aims to solve the existing problems, and provides a lifting rubber strip for a shower room, which is simple in structure, reasonable in design, easy to realize, convenient to install and disassemble, free of lifting the whole shower glass, simpler in lifting mode and good in water retaining performance; in addition, the lifting rubber strip is suitable for various house types, has wide application range and long service life, and is easy to meet the requirements of production, preparation and use;
in order to achieve the purpose, the invention adopts the following technical scheme:
a lifting adhesive tape for a shower room comprises a first adhesive tape, wherein the first adhesive tape is arranged at the bottom of shower glass; the magnetic strip pushing device also comprises a second adhesive strip, a first magnetic strip, a second magnetic strip and a pushing assembly; the second adhesive tape is sleeved below the first adhesive tape correspondingly, and the first adhesive tape and the second adhesive tape are matched through a lifting limiting structure; the first magnetic stripe and the second magnetic stripe are respectively arranged in the first adhesive tape and the second adhesive tape, and the first magnetic stripe and the second magnetic stripe are respectively composed of a plurality of single magnetic pole sections, and each single magnetic pole section is formed by cross arrangement of S poles and N poles; the pushing assembly is arranged on the axial side of the shower glass and acts on the first or second magnetic strip; the pushing assembly pushes any magnetic strip after being pressed, and S poles and N poles of the single magnetic pole sections of the first magnetic strip and the second magnetic strip are corresponding or staggered, so that the first magnetic strip and the second magnetic strip attract or repel each other, and the first adhesive strip and the second adhesive strip are driven to ascend or descend.
Furthermore, the lifting limiting structure comprises limiting convex parts formed on two side edges of the first rubber strip and a hanging table part arranged on the inner cavity wall of the second rubber strip; a lifting displacement area is formed between the bottom of the inner cavity of the second rubber strip and the table hanging part, and the lifting displacement area is used for the limit convex part to be placed in and to be lifted and displaced; and the second adhesive tape descends and displaces, and the upper hanging table part of the second adhesive tape is in limit fit with the limit convex part on the first adhesive tape.
Furthermore, the limiting convex part is provided with an anti-falling groove; and an embedding part matched with the anti-falling groove is formed on the hanging table part, wherein the embedding part on the hanging table part is inserted in the anti-falling groove to slide so as to ensure that the first adhesive tape and the second adhesive tape are lifted, limited and matched.
Furthermore, the ejection assembly comprises a first connecting seat, a second connecting seat and a movable ejector block, and the two connecting seats are respectively arranged on the side edges of the first adhesive tape and the second adhesive tape; the movable push block is arranged in the first or second connecting seat and acts on the first or second magnetic strip; after the movable push block is pressed, the first magnetic strip or the second magnetic strip is pushed to move.
Furthermore, the ejection component further comprises a first return spring, and two ends of the first return spring are respectively acted on the first connecting seat and the second magnetic strip to reversely push the pressed magnetic strips to reset and link the second adhesive strips to move upwards.
Furthermore, the first connecting seat is also provided with an elastic force adjusting structure; the elastic force adjusting structure comprises a jackscrew and a pressing block, wherein one end of the jackscrew is a driving end, and the other end of the jackscrew abuts against the pressing block; the pressing block is pressed on the first return spring.
Furthermore, the magnetic strip pushing device further comprises a second return spring, and two ends of the second return spring respectively act on the movable pushing block and the second magnetic strip.
Furthermore, the second adhesive tape is arranged in a convex shape, and two sides of the second adhesive tape extend to the bottoms of the two connecting seats.

Detailed Description
In order to make the technical problems, technical solutions and advantageous effects to be solved by the present invention clearer and clearer, the present invention is further described in detail below with reference to the accompanying drawings and embodiments. It should be understood that the specific embodiments described herein are merely illustrative of the invention and are not intended to limit the invention.
As shown in figures 1 to 4, the lifting rubber strip for the shower room comprises a first rubber strip 1, wherein the first rubber strip 1 is arranged at the bottom of shower glass 2;
the magnetic strip pushing device also comprises a second adhesive tape 3, a first magnetic strip 4, a second magnetic strip 5 and a pushing assembly 6; the second adhesive tape 3 is sleeved below the first adhesive tape 1 correspondingly, and the first adhesive tape 1 and the second adhesive tape 3 are matched through a lifting limiting structure 7;
as shown in fig. 2 and 3, the lifting limiting structure 7 comprises limiting convex parts 71 formed on two side edges of the first rubber strip 1 and a hanging table part 72 arranged on the inner cavity wall of the second rubber strip 3; a lifting displacement area 73 is formed between the bottom of the inner cavity of the second rubber strip 3 and the hanging table part 72, and the lifting displacement area 73 is used for the limit convex part 71 to be placed in and to be lifted and displaced; wherein, the second adhesive tape 3 descends and displaces, and the upper hanging table part 72 and the limit convex part 71 on the first adhesive tape 1 form limit fit;
the limit convex part 71 is provided with an anti-drop groove 710; the hooking part 72 is formed with an embedding part 720 matching with the anti-falling groove 710, wherein the embedding part 720 on the hooking part 72 is inserted and slides in the anti-falling groove 710, so that the first adhesive tape 1 and the second adhesive tape 3 are in lifting limit matching.
As shown in fig. 1, 2 and 7, the first and second magnetic strips 4 and 5 are respectively mounted in the first and second adhesive tapes 1 and 3, the first and second magnetic strips 4 and 5 are respectively composed of a plurality of single magnetic pole sections 40 and 50, and each single magnetic pole section 40 and 50 is formed by arranging S and N poles in a crossed manner;
as shown in fig. 8, the pushing assembly 6 is installed at the side of the shower glass 2 in the axial direction and acts on the first or second magnetic strips 4, 5; the ejection component 6 comprises a first connecting seat 61, a second connecting seat 62 and a movable push block 63, and the two connecting seats 61, 62 are respectively arranged at the side edges of the first rubber strip 1 and the second rubber strip 3; the movable push block 63 is arranged in the first or second connecting seat 61, 62 and acts on the first or second magnetic strip 4, 5; after the movable push block is pressed, the first or second magnetic strips 4 and 5 are pushed to move.
The ejection component 6 further comprises a first return spring 64, two ends of the first return spring 64 act on the first connecting seat 61 and the second magnetic strip 5 respectively to reversely push the pressed magnetic strip 5 to reset, and the second adhesive strip 3 is linked to move upwards.
The pushing assembly 6 pushes any one of the magnetic strips 4 and 5 after being pressed, and S poles and N poles of the single magnetic pole sections 40 and 50 of the first magnetic strip 4 and the second magnetic strip 5 are corresponding or staggered, so that the first magnetic strip 4 and the second magnetic strip 5 attract or repel each other to drive the first adhesive strip 1 and the second adhesive strip 3 to ascend or descend.
More specifically, as shown in fig. 9, the first connecting seat 61 is further provided with an elastic force adjusting structure 8; the elastic force adjusting structure 8 comprises a jackscrew 81 and a pressing block 82, one end of the jackscrew 81 is a driving end 81A, and the other end of the jackscrew abuts against the pressing block 82; the pressure piece 82 is pressed against the first return spring 64.
More specifically, the magnetic force sensor further comprises a second return spring 65, and two ends of the second return spring 65 respectively act on the movable push block 63 and the second magnetic strip 5.
More specifically, the second adhesive tape 3 is disposed in a convex shape, and both sides of the second adhesive tape 3 extend to the bottoms of the two connecting bases 61, 62.
In the specific implementation mode, as shown in fig. 1 to 9, the lifting rubber strip for the shower room mainly comprises the following components: the shower bath comprises a first adhesive tape 1, shower glass 2, a second adhesive tape 3, first and second magnetic strips 4 and 5, first and second connecting seats 61 and 62, a movable push block 63, first and second return springs 64 and 65, a jackscrew 81 and a press block 82;
in the actual assembly and use process, firstly, the first magnetic strip 4 and the second magnetic strip 5 are respectively arranged on the first adhesive tape 1 and the second adhesive tape 3; (as shown in fig. 7) the first and second magnetic strips 4, 5 are respectively composed of a plurality of single magnetic pole sections 40, 50, each single magnetic pole section 40, 50 is composed of a crossed arrangement of S and N poles, when the magnetic poles of the first and second magnetic strips 4, 5 are opposite, the first and second magnetic strips 4, 5 attract each other, if the magnetic poles are the same, the two repel each other;
secondly, the first magnetic stripe 4 and the second magnetic stripe 5 are matched in a sleeved mode, limiting convex parts 71 formed on two side edges of the first rubber stripe 1 and a hanging table part 72 provided with the inner cavity wall of the second rubber stripe 3 are oppositely arranged, so that the limiting convex parts 71 move up and down in the lifting displacement area 73, in addition, as the limiting convex parts 71 are provided with anti-falling grooves 710, embedding parts 720 matched with the anti-falling grooves 710 are formed in the hanging table part 72, and the first rubber stripe 1 and the second rubber stripe 3 are not easy to fall off in the lifting process due to the fact that the limiting convex parts 71 are provided with the anti-falling grooves 710 and the embedding parts are mutually embedded; after the first adhesive tape 1 and the second adhesive tape 3 are installed, connecting the first adhesive tape 1 with the shower glass 2;
finally, the pushing assembly 6 is arranged on the shower glass 2; the first connecting seat 61 and the second connecting seat 62 of the pushing structure 6 are respectively connected corresponding to two sides of the rubber strip, and the movable pushing block 63 which is arranged in the second connecting seat 62 in a sliding way is propped against the second magnetic strip 5, so that the pushing function is realized when the buffer block or the side frame body of the shower room is impacted during the door opening and closing; if one-side pushing is required to be realized, and the automatic reset function is realized after the pushing is released, a first reset spring 64 is arranged on the first connecting seat 61, and two ends of the first reset spring 64 respectively act on the first connecting seat 61 and the second magnetic strip 5 so as to reversely push the pressed second magnetic strip 5 to reset; in addition, a jackscrew 81 and a pressing block 82 can be further arranged at the first connecting seat 61, one end of the jackscrew 81 is a driving end 81A, the other end of the jackscrew abuts against the pressing block 82, the pressing block 82 is pressed on the first return spring 64, and the resilience force of the first return spring 64 is adjusted by adjusting the driving end 81A of the jackscrew 81; moreover, a second return spring 65 can be arranged on the movable push block 63 and the second magnetic strip 5 to improve the rebound effect;
in the actual use process, as shown in fig. 10, when the door is opened, the first and second magnetic strips 4 and 5 are in the attraction state, so that the first and second adhesive tapes 1 and 3 are attached to each other; when the shower glass 2 is pushed to close and slide, as shown in fig. 11, the shower glass 2 drives the first adhesive tape 1 and the second adhesive tape 3 to synchronously displace in the sliding process at this time, until the movable push block 63 on the shower glass 2 collides with the side frame body of the shower room door frame, the linkage second return spring 65 contracts, the movable push block 63 is compressed and pushes the second magnetic stripe 5 to displace, at this time, the polarities of the S and N poles of the single magnetic pole sections 40 and 50 on the second magnetic stripe 5 are the same as those of the S and N poles on the first magnetic stripe, and then the two magnetic stripes 4 and 5 generate repulsive force, so that the second adhesive tape 3 with the second magnetic stripe 5 descends, and meanwhile, the first return spring 64 is also compressed and deformed; the descending second adhesive tape 3 is abutted against the ground to perform water prevention and water sealing (as shown in fig. 12, in order to ensure the integral aesthetic degree, the edges of the first and second connecting seats 61 and 62 are flush with the edge of the shower glass 2, so that the length of the first and second adhesive tapes 1 and 3 is smaller than the width of the shower glass 2 due to the positions occupied by the first and second connecting seats 61 and 62, no water is retained below the first and second connecting seats 61 and 62, and in order to achieve the complete water prevention function, the second adhesive tape 3 is arranged in a convex shape, so that the bottom of the second adhesive tape 3 is consistent with the width of the shower glass 2, and the water sealing and water prevention effects are better);
when opening the door, activity ejector pad 63 on the second connecting seat has lost the jacking force, first reset spring 64 'S resilience power is used on second magnetic stripe 5 this moment, make the S of the single magnetic pole interval 50 of second magnetic stripe 5, S on N utmost point and the first magnetic stripe 4, the polarity of N utmost point is opposite, and then first, second magnetic stripe 4, 5 are inhaled mutually, adsorb second adhesive tape 3 and rise, and laminate with first adhesive tape 1, the in-process that rises here, second reset spring 65 promotes the reset fast with activity ejector pad 63, reduce first reset spring 64' S resilience force, make the reset that second adhesive tape 3 can be more quick.
